Weight chart for boys 16 years 10 months of age

97th percentile93.06-over 93.06kgs
95th percentile88.13-93.06kgs
90th percentile81.46-88.13kgs
75th percentile72.27-81.46kgs
50th percentile64.17-72.27kgs
25th percentile57.68-64.17kgs
10th percentile52.84-57.68kgs
5th percentile50.3-52.84kgs
3rd percentile0-50.3kgs

How to read this weight chart for boys:

This chart shows weight percentiles, according to the CDC, for boys 16 years 10 months of age. To determine an individual's percentile, find the range that includes their weight. This percentile is not a reflection of optimal weight for an individual, it is only for comparing against a population sample.
